Originally Posted by SDGeneralCounsel
Vinyl is a little harder than tint to install, so NOT any tint shop can install overlays. Also, any individual, even with no experience, that is willing to be patient while installing the vinyl can install it himself as well. However, if you are anywhere near the installers listed in the first post, I would highly recommend going to them to do you install. Going through any of the recommended installers would be less expensive (50% less or more in most instances) than going though a tint or other shop, and you can count on receiving the best install that is possible.

I've worked a lot with Bluebatmobile's vinyl and have had it on my car for years now, without any issue. It's very durable and is pretty easy to install.
